Doune Castle is a remarkable medieval fortress nestled in the picturesque landscape of central Scotland. Built in the 14th century, this castle is renowned for its impressive architecture and historical significance. With its towering stone walls and well-preserved interiors, Doune Castle offers visitors a unique glimpse into Scotland's turbulent past. The castle is famously associated with the legendary figure of Robert the Bruce and has served as a filming location for popular movies and TV shows, including 'Monty Python and the Holy Grail' and 'Outlander'. Getting There
-
Car
From the main roads within Loch Lomond & The Trossachs National Park, head towards the A84 road. If you're near Callander, take the A81 towards Doune. After approximately 10 miles, you will arrive at Doune. Once in Doune, follow signs for Doune Castle, located at Castle Hill, Doune FK16 6EA. There is a car park available near the castle. Note that parking may incur a small fee.
-
Public Transportation
If you prefer public transport, take a bus from various locations in Loch Lomond & The Trossachs National Park to Callander. From Callander, you can catch the number 59 bus towards Stirling, which will stop in Doune. The bus journey from Callander to Doune takes about 15 minutes. Once you get off the bus in Doune, it’s a short walk to Doune Castle, following the signs to Castle Hill. Be sure to check the local bus schedules for the most current times.
-
Walking
If you are in Doune and prefer to walk, Doune Castle is within walking distance from the village center. Simply head north on the Main Street, then turn right onto Castle Hill. The castle is well-signposted and should take approximately 15-20 minutes to reach on foot.
